Well there is a straightforward way that is very prone to breaking should any of the tags change. The chosen pick will have the correct feat tag, e.g., fChainSpl, field. One can then code another huge if-statement block that goes through and if the chosen matches a particular one then set a string for the metamagic item. Pseudo code example: var str1 as string var str2 as string str1=field[fChosen].chosen.idstring if (str1="fHeightenSpl") then str2="mmHeighten" elseif (str1="fQuickenSpl") then str2="mmQuicken" elseif... ... endif Problem is (1) this feat will not function for a new metamagic feat unless it is added and (2) it will be a HUGE script.
